RWE and PGE have completed the transaction announced in December, under which PGE has become the sole owner of the F.E.W. Baltic II offshore wind development project in the Polish Baltic Sea. The project has a planned capacity of 350 MW and will be located approximately 50 kilometres offshore, north of the Polish town of Ustka.

In addition, the parties finalised the transfer of the environmental decision and related data for the adjacent 44.E.1. development site from RWE to PGE at the end of last year. PGE intends to combine the Baltic II project with its neighbouring Baltica 9 project, which has a capacity of 975 MW, creating a combined offshore wind area with a total capacity of around 1.3 GW.
